I know Outlook email is supported by Thunderbird, as that is what I use on multiple platforms. There was an issue a few months back when MS introduced oAuth security. See this, and links within that refer to Outlook.com Get started with Thunderbird | Thunderbird Help
Thunderbird, Betterbird & Evolution all should work with outlook.com.
And noted by jesseekoh, you will have to use 2 factor authentication. If I recall correctly when setting up outlook.com the setup process directed me to go to my Microsoft/outlook account and "authorize" it to work. Hope this helps.
